Un-Expected was a story I’d been fiddling with for a while as a standalone. I’d been wanting to do a story set in a quiet English country village, the kind where everyone knows everyone’s business. The male midwife idea had been bugging me too, so I decided to kill two birds with one stone as it were. But then my bestie, Sue Brown, contacted me and said she wanted to write a series with me, set in the UK. Of course I said yes and suggested that the midwife story I was working on be the first one. She agreed and off we went. Left at the Crossroads was born. I’d co-written before so I’d be lying if I said I wasn’t a little apprehensive, because Sue and I have quite different styles and I wondered how we were going to pull it off – for about three seconds when she said that we’d write a book each as I was already part way into Un-Expected.

I had a blast creating Micah, his mum and the village they’ve lived in forever. I kind of had a Miss Marple-esque idea going on, and wanted to show that, although it was a country village and sometimes the image is one of just letting life tick by, that’s not the case in Little Mowbury. Everyone has their secrets and their insecurities, even Doris Abernathy, the Post Mistress, who seems to know everyone else’s! To find out what they are, you’ll have to visit Little Mowbury. If you get lost, just ask for directions, everyone will tell you… it’s Left at the Crossroads.


Blurb

CoverLittle Mowbury is a sleepy English village deep in the Cotswolds. The kind of village where you’re only a local if your lineage can be traced back to the dinosaurs. Where you can find everything in the single shop from morning newspapers to dry-cleaning, and getting your shoes mended. And, of course, where everybody knows everybody else’s business. It’s easy to find… you can’t miss it… just ask anyone and they’ll tell you… “It’s left at the crossroads.”

After being dumped on graduation day by the love of his life, Harry Boyd, Micah Lewis returned to the sleepy village he grew up in. Living next door to his mother wasn’t his best idea, granted, but when your heart was broken, there really was no place like home.

Six years later, secure and content in his job as midwife for a local birthing centre, the last person he expected to move into Lilac Cottage across the street from him was Harry Boyd. Seeing Harry again sends Micah into a tailspin and opens wounds he thought had long since healed. Although, Harry himself isn’t the only issue Micah has to face. That would be Harry’s very beautiful and very pregnant partner, Selena. But is everything as it seems?
